The agricultural sector is increasingly focused on efficiency and productivity, especially in controlled environments like greenhouses and livestock facilities. Agricultural air handling systems play a crucial role in maintaining optimal indoor conditions by regulating temperature, humidity, and airflow. These systems ensure that crops and livestock receive the best possible growing and living conditions, thereby enhancing yield and overall productivity. With advancements in technology and an increasing emphasis on sustainable farming practices, the market for agricultural air handling systems is witnessing significant growth.

Market Size, Share, & Trends Analysis
As of 2023, the global agricultural air handling system market is estimated to be valued at approximately $1.2 billion and is projected to grow at a CAGR (Compound Annual Growth Rate) of 6.5% from 2024 to 2029. The growth can be attributed to several factors, including technological advancements, an increase in greenhouse farming, and the rising need for climate control in livestock farming.Market Segmentation by Product Type
The market is segmented based on product type into:- Single Blower System: This segment holds a significant share of the market due to its simplicity and cost-effectiveness. The single blower system is preferred in smaller setups where high airflow rates are not a necessity.
- Dual Blower System: This system provides higher airflow and is generally used in larger agricultural applications, including extensive livestock operations and larger greenhouses. Its share in the market is, however, growing due to its enhanced performance.

Market Segmentation by Process
The agricultural air handling system market can also be categorized based on process, including:- Heating: Essential in cold climates to maintain desirable growing conditions.
- Cooling: Critical during hot weather to prevent heat stress in crops and animals.
- Ventilation: Ensures proper air circulation which is vital for maintaining the health of crops and livestock.
Market Segmentation by Application
The primary applications of agricultural air handling systems include:- Greenhouse: The use of air handling systems in greenhouses helps optimize the growing conditions, which are vital for high crop yields.
- Livestock Farming: These systems are employed to regulate airflow and climate to ensure animal comfort and health, thereby enhancing productivity.

Market Trends and Insights
Some noteworthy trends impacting the agricultural air handling system market include:- Sustainable Practices: There's an increasing demand for energy-efficient systems that not only reduce operational costs but also minimize environmental impact.
- Technological Integration: The adoption of IoT (Internet of Things) technology to monitor and control air handling systems remotely is gaining traction.
- Focus on Indoor Farming: With urbanization and space constraints, indoor farming is becoming more popular, further driving the demand for advanced air handling systems.
